One community rink closed after fire

One of three community rinks at the WFCU Centre is out of service after a fire at the facility Monday morning.

The $1 million in damage was concentrated above the AM800 CKLW community rink. All rentals for this rink will be relocated to the WFCU Centre main bowl area.

All other scheduled programming at the WFCU Centre will resume as planned at 12:00 p.m. Tuesday, April 29, 2025.

Officials with the City of Windsor indicated they have taken all necessary precautions to ensure the safety of all users of the facility.

The cause of the fire is still under investigation.
